2014 has seen the spawn of the Foo Fighters and Chevy Metal and it is known as The Birds of Satan!

Foo Fighters drummer Taylor Hawkins has combined forces with Chevy Metal’s Wiley Hodgden and Mick Murphy to form what is being called an “American Progressive Rock Super Group.” This trio has assembled and already released a seven track self-titled disc that pays homage to a slew of 70’s groups like Queen, David Bowie, Aerosmith and more. Even fellow Foo Fighters Dave Grohl, Rami Jaffee and Pat Smear are all featured on the disc as well.

Track 1, “The Ballad of The Birds of Satan” sets the tone right out of the shoot with what can only be classified as their “opus;” a nine minute and twenty eight second roller coaster ride that has more twists, turns, stops, starts and timing changes then a steep mountain road.

The disc’s current single and Track 2 “Thanks For The Line,” is a syncopated, upbeat rocker with a Queen-like mid-section and bridge that gives way to the choppy, yet driving rhythm that makes this tune go.

The third track, “Pieces Of The Puzzle,” much like the entire album, features great drum and guitar work. This tune definitely has punk overtones and a definitively progressive sound; yet is packaged in a neat pop style that resonates well as the band flows from one style to the next flawlessly.

“Raspberries” is next in the four slot, which is shocking, as just when you think the boys are going to slow things down a bit with this offering; they kick it up a notch and it’s off to the races. This is perhaps the straightest forward cut on the record when it comes to just pure drive. Noticeably absent are the multiple changes that are present throughout the majority of this disc.

One of the things that will make this album a standout new release is the band makes incredible use of dynamics from start to finish. Track 5, “Nothing At All,” combines acoustic and electric guitar with some very poignant style changes and dominant drum parts; making this a great toe tapper or head banger whichever you prefer to do.

Track 6, “Wait Til Tomorrow” is once again full of timing changes over a fast punk beat and just flat out rocks from start to finish. With lyrics like, “Why can’t it wait til tomorrow, one more bad mistake is all I want…” the band gets your attention and holds it; don’t blink, you may miss something.

Finishing up this initial compilation of great talents and styles is the seventh and final Track, “Too Far Gone To See.” Like the opening cut which starts off with drums, this obviously slower piece with techno sound effects ends the same way; with Hawkins closing the door after another great riff laden passage.

Overall, it is amazing how these guys and this disc have flown under the radar a bit. Rife with superior musicianship, talent and songwriting; this is one of the better debut efforts produced in a very long time. Murphy’s guitar work simply sizzles throughout, Hodgden’s bass and at times haunting vocals force you to pay attention and Hawkins’ drum work proves that he fits easily into the upper echelon of his ilk. Shanabelle Records has a definite hit on their hands as they distribute this on iTunes and Amazon.
